Ordinals
beta
Address 1QLCuBzRubAsEsysDhztv21JHAdcfdMWzd
sat balance
26009
runes balances
outputs
1c191b1c30d4af62d179157f244c998ca8bfff46eba317e6b215a3d01b44ca4f:4
273af8d1c2995d7ea80c32f38a347694159b84dfcb7c7ad0294a40ad48cb7878:483